I watched a disc of the video footage from the game (too old to play the game itself), and there isn't an hours worth of pure film.

Some scenes are part motion picture and part video game animation (i.e. real actor crashes through a window, but animated actor drops to sidewalk below). So we're likely going to see more than what was seen in the game.

And by the same token, lots of the game footage will NOT be in the movie, since there are several scenes in the game which are played out identically except with different characters depending on who the player was playing as, or what route that particular game went down. For example, the smoochy lady (friend of the Valedectorian or whatever he was called) kisses two different characters in otherwise identical scenes, for example.

The game footage has a couple gems - more scenes of the meeting in the basement (the location where former-Agent Smith shows up and delivers his ear-piece through the doorslot), and more of the power plant attack which I've always said was sloppily edited in the theatrical version and badly needed to be redone. Though it is too bad that the power plant attack was carried out by Jada Pinkett Smith... ouch, what a 2-dimensional performance she turned in.

There's also lots of really bad game footage, including Jada's co-pilot who tells lame jokes as he's flying their ship around.
